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w

Dough 349 kcal / 100 g FSVO V7.1

100 g of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w provides 349 kcal (1,450 kJ). Its composition stands out for its content of fat (23.2 g) per 100 g. This food belongs to the “Dough” category (“Cereal products, pulses and potatoes” family) of the Swiss database.

Detailed composition

for 100 g
NutrientValue% NRV*
Macronutrients
Energy349 kcal (1,450 kJ)C17%
Protein5.2 gC10%
Fat23.2 gC33%
of which saturated fat7.1 gC36%
of which polyunsaturated4.4 gCn/a
of which omega-30.6 gCn/a
Carbohydrates29.3 gC11%
of which sugars0.2 gC0%
Dietary fibre1.3 gC4%
Water41.5 gCn/a
Alcohol0 gCn/a
Minerals
Calcium10 mgC1%
Iron0.7 mgC5%
Magnesium15 mgC4%
Phosphorus58 mgC8%
Potassium88 mgC4%
Sodium360 mgC15%
Zinc0.5 mgC5%
Vitamins
Vitamin D1 µgC20%
Vitamin B120 µgC0%
Vitamin C0 mgC0%
Folate7 µgC4%

* Share of the nutrient reference values for adults (Swiss FIC ordinance, annex 10), for the displayed portion. For dietary fibre the annex sets no value: the 30 g a day is an indicative benchmark. “n/a”: value not available in the source, never estimated by us. A, E or C indicates each value’s origin.

Frequently asked questions

How many calories in 100 g of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w?
100 g of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w provides 349 kcal, i.e. 1,450 kJ (FSVO data V7.1).
How much protein in 100 g of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w?
100 g provides 5.2 g of protein, i.e. 10% of the adult reference value (50 g).
What is the fat content of 100 g of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w?
100 g contains 23.2 g of fat, of which 7.1 g saturated fatty acids.
Where do these values come from?
From the Swiss food composition database V7.1 published by the FSVO (July 2026). Every value carries an origin indicator: A (measured), E (estimated) or C (calculated).
Which preparation state do the values refer to?
To the official label “Puff pastry, home-made (with vegetable fat), raw” in the database: the state (raw, cooked, drained…) is specified where relevant. Preparation substantially changes the composition per 100 g, especially the water content.
